本文将为您详细介绍日期计算天数的基本步骤,涵盖确定起始日期和结束日期、识别闰年规则、处理不同月份天数的差异、考虑时区差异、使用合适的工具或算法以及验证计算结果的准确性。无论是日常工作还是人力资源管理,这些技巧都将助您一臂之力。
确定起始日期和结束日期
日期计算的第一步是明确起始日期和结束日期。这看似简单,但在实际操作中需要注意一些细节,以确保计算的准确性。
1. 确定格式统一的重要性
在确定日期时,确保所使用的日期格式统一(如YYYY-MM-DD)。不同的日期格式可能导致计算误差,特别是在跨系统操作时。
2. 示例场景
假设我们需要计算2025年1月1日到2025年12月31日之间的天数。明确起止日期后,可以减少计算中的错误。
识别闰年规则对计算的影响
闰年规则是日期计算中一个重要的影响因素。每四年一次的闰年会增加一天,这对全年计算有直接影响。
1. 闰年规则简介
从实践来看,闰年规则可以简单总结为:年份能被4整除且不能被100整除,或者能被400整除的年份为闰年。例如,2024年是闰年,但2025年不是。
2. 实践中的应用
在计算天数时,若跨越了闰年,就需要额外加一天。例如,2024年2月有29天,而其他年份的2月只有28天。
处理不同月份天数的差异
不同月份的天数不同,这对日期计算的准确性也有很大影响。
1. 每月天数一览
一般来说,1月、3月、5月、7月、8月、10月和12月有31天;4月、6月、9月和11月有30天;2月则有28天或29天(闰年)。
月份 | 天数 |
---|---|
1月 | 31 |
2月 | 28/29 |
3月 | 31 |
4月 | 30 |
5月 | 31 |
6月 | 30 |
7月 | 31 |
8月 | 31 |
9月 | 30 |
10月 | 31 |
11月 | 30 |
12月 | 31 |
2. 示例场景
计算2025年1月1日到2025年3月1日的天数时,需要考虑1月和2月的天数分别为31天和28天。
考虑时区差异对日期计算的影响
在全球化的背景下,跨时区的日期计算变得越来越普遍。时区差异可能会影响日期的精确性。
1. 时区基础知识
地球划分为24个时区,每个时区相差1小时。UTC(协调世界时)是计算时区差异的基准。
2. 实践中的考虑
例如,从上海(UTC+8)到纽约(UTC-5),由于时区差异,实际日期可能会提前或延后1天。
使用合适的工具或算法进行计算
选择合适的工具和算法可以大大简化日期计算过程,提升准确性和效率。我推荐利唐i人事,这是一款专业的人事软件,覆盖薪资、绩效、组织人事、考勤、招聘、培训等功能,能够有效处理日期计算等问题。
1. 常用计算工具
电子表格软件(如Excel)和编程语言(如Python、JavaScript)都提供了日期计算的内置函数。例如,Excel中的DATEDIF函数可以快速计算两个日期间的天数。
2. 利唐i人事的优势
利唐i人事不仅能够进行复杂的日期计算,还能整合人力资源管理的各个方面,使您的工作更加高效。
验证计算结果的准确性
任何计算步骤的然后一步都是验证结果的准确性。通过多种方法对结果进行校验,可以确保计算的可靠性。
1. 交叉验证方法
使用不同的工具或方法进行计算,然后对比结果。例如,可以同时使用Excel和Python进行日期计算,确保结果一致。
2. 实践中的应用
计算2025年1月1日到2025年12月31日的天数时,用电子表格和编程语言分别计算,得到的结果应一致,为365天。
通过上述步骤,您可以掌握日期计算的基本方法,避免常见错误并提高计算的准确性。无论是个人日常生活还是企业管理,掌握这些技巧都将大有裨益。
总结:日期计算不仅仅是简单的加减法,还涉及到多种因素的综合考虑,如闰年、月份天数、时区差异等。选择合适的工具和算法,并进行充分的验证,可以大大提高计算的准确性和效率。我推荐使用利唐i人事这款专业的人事软件,它可以帮助您更好地处理复杂的日期计算问题,提升企业信息化和人力资源数字化管理水平。在实际操作中,关注细节、选择合适的工具,并进行多次验证,是保证日期计算准确性的不二法门。
利唐i人事HR社区,发布者:HR_learner,转转请注明出处:https://www.ihr360.com/hrnews/202501224395.html